NEOM CEO says work progressing in Red Sea destination

Nadhmi Al-Nasr, CEO of NEOM and board member of Red Sea Global (RSG), highlighted the remarkable progress in the Red Sea destination, indicating that the project will contribute to boosting the Kingdom’s position on the global tourism map.

 

 

 

He pointed to the great efforts made by RSG to contribute to achieving Vision 2030 goals, Saudi Press Agency reported.

 

 

 

The project will be a key driver to the local tourism sector, Nadhmi noted.

 

 

 

John Pagano, CEO of RSG, recently said the company is on track to deliver its target of opening three resorts this year, as reported earlier by Argaam.

 

 

 

The Red Sea project will have 50 resorts and hotels when it is finished in 2030, offering up to 8,000 hotel rooms, and 1,300 residential properties spread across 22 islands and six inland sites. It will also include luxurious marinas, golf courses, and several leisure and entertainment facilities.
